The utility model provides a high-slope cable mobile construction platform based on concrete embedded piers, which relates to the technical field of high-slope construction platforms. The technology includes a mobile work platform, which is connected to a cable retracting system, and the cable retracting system is installed on a concrete embedded structure. When the utility model is used, on a high slope that needs to be supported, a number of embedded grooves are excavated according to demand, the concrete piers are embedded in the embedded grooves, and concrete is poured; the mobile work platform is installed with a pulley on one side to contact the high slope, and the mobile work platform is moved up and down by the cable, and the anchor rod is installed and fixed when it reaches the working surface to increase safety; the utility model has a simple structure and is easy to construct on site. Compared with setting up scaffolding, the construction period is greatly shortened, and in the face of complex high slope support The construction condition is not timely, remedial work can be carried out in time.

背景技术Background technique

在工程实践中,各类高边坡施工作业时要求即时开挖及时支护,但实际工程中往往不能做到,现有技术中常用搭设脚手架的方式开展高边坡支护工作然而因实际场地地势、岩性和分级开挖等限制原因,脚手架搭设难度过大从而制约工期,因为需要一种新的施工辅助手段。In engineering practice, all kinds of high slope construction work require immediate excavation and timely support, but this is often not possible in actual projects. In the existing technology, scaffolding is often used to carry out high slope support work. However, due to the actual site topography, rock properties and graded excavation, the scaffolding is too difficult to set up, which restricts the construction period. Therefore, a new construction auxiliary means is needed.

公开号为CN109403357A的文件公开了一种移动式高边坡施工平台简易装置包括四轮底座和围栏工作平台;四轮底座通过角度控制杆和围栏工作平台连接;所述围栏工作平台的一侧连接有提升机构。本发明主体结构由钢管扣接而成,通过调整钢管长度、扣件位置即可控制装置的尺寸、平台与坡面的夹角,从而适用于各类施工和较大坡度范围,保证边坡施工平台平衡。经分析该公开文件中虽提出了一种移动式施工平台,但并未明确移动施工作业平台与地面的固定方式,并且在施工作业中该移动式高边坡施工平台并不能临时固定在高边坡上,因此这部分结构需要进行改进。The document with the publication number CN109403357A discloses a simple mobile high-slope construction platform device including a four-wheel base and a fence work platform; the four-wheel base is connected to the fence work platform through an angle control rod; one side of the fence work platform is connected to a lifting mechanism. The main structure of the present invention is made of steel pipes, and the size of the device and the angle between the platform and the slope can be controlled by adjusting the length of the steel pipe and the position of the fasteners, so that it is suitable for various types of construction and a large slope range, ensuring the balance of the slope construction platform. After analysis, although a mobile construction platform is proposed in the public document, the fixing method of the mobile construction work platform and the ground is not clear, and the mobile high-slope construction platform cannot be temporarily fixed on the high slope during construction, so this part of the structure needs to be improved.

实施例。一种基于混凝土嵌固墩的高边坡缆机移动施工平台,结构参考图1-2,包括高边坡1,高边坡1的顶部设置有一组与混凝土墩4匹配的嵌固槽2;高边坡1的侧边设置有移动作业平台7,移动作业平台7与缆机收放系统连接,缆机收放系统安装在混凝土嵌固结构上,所述混凝土嵌固结构包括若干混凝土墩4,混凝土墩4内设置有若干插筋3,插筋3的底部从混凝土墩4内伸出,混凝土墩4和插筋3设置在嵌固槽2中。Embodiment. A high-slope cable mobile construction platform based on concrete embedded piers, with reference to FIG1-2 for structure, comprises a high slope 1, a group of embedded grooves 2 matching with concrete piers 4 are arranged on the top of the high slope 1; a mobile working platform 7 is arranged on the side of the high slope 1, the mobile working platform 7 is connected to a cable crane retracting and releasing system, and the cable crane retracting and releasing system is installed on the concrete embedded structure, the concrete embedded structure comprises a plurality of concrete piers 4, a plurality of dowels 3 are arranged in the concrete piers 4, the bottom of the dowels 3 extend out from the concrete piers 4, and the concrete piers 4 and the dowels 3 are arranged in the embedded grooves 2.

所述缆机收放系统包括若干缆机5,每个缆机5通过钢绞线6连接移动作业平台7的顶部外侧,缆机5皆固定安装在混凝土墩4上。The cable crane retracting and releasing system includes a plurality of cables 5 , each of which is connected to the top outer side of a mobile working platform 7 via a steel strand 6 , and the cables 5 are all fixedly mounted on a concrete pier 4 .

所述混凝土墩4设有两个,混凝土墩4上各设有一个缆机5。There are two concrete piers 4 , each of which is provided with a cable car 5 .

所述移动作业平台7的顶部内侧设置有若干固定锚杆8。A plurality of fixed anchor rods 8 are arranged on the inner side of the top of the mobile working platform 7 .

所述固定锚杆8与高边坡1活动连接。The fixed anchor rod 8 is movably connected to the high slope 1 .

所述移动作业平台7的内侧设置有若干组滑轮9。A plurality of pulleys 9 are arranged on the inner side of the mobile working platform 7 .

所述移动作业平台7的内侧的左端和右端各设置有一组滑轮9。A set of pulleys 9 is respectively provided at the left and right ends of the inner side of the mobile working platform 7 .

本实用新型的使用方法:在需要支护的高边坡上,根据需求开挖若干嵌固槽2,制作混凝土墩4,制作时设置若干插筋3并保持插筋3伸出混凝土墩4的底部,待混凝土墩4凝固后将插筋3朝下与混凝土墩4一起放入嵌固槽2中并浇筑混凝土,待混凝土凝固后,在混凝土墩4上安装缆机5,缆机5通过钢绞线6连接移动作业平台7,将移动作业平台7安装有滑轮9一侧与高边坡接触,通过缆机5实现移动作业平台7的上下移动,当到达工作面时安装并固定锚杆8,即可开始支护工作。The method of using the utility model is as follows: on a high slope that needs to be supported, a number of embedded grooves 2 are excavated according to needs, and concrete piers 4 are made. During the making, a number of dowel bars 3 are arranged and kept extending out of the bottom of the concrete pier 4. After the concrete pier 4 solidifies, the dowel bars 3 are placed downward together with the concrete pier 4 into the embedded grooves 2 and concrete is poured. After the concrete solidifies, a cable crane 5 is installed on the concrete pier 4. The cable crane 5 is connected to a mobile working platform 7 through a steel strand 6. The mobile working platform 7 is installed with a pulley 9 on one side in contact with the high slope. The mobile working platform 7 is moved up and down by the cable crane 5. When the working surface is reached, the anchor rod 8 is installed and fixed, and the support work can begin.
